Transaction 1faeea5b1af5d120ac99b06d31c2ecbc8e677acedc7a2213a2ba58d4245e12a6

1 Input
2 Outputs
  • 1faeea5b1af5d120ac99b06d31c2ecbc8e677acedc7a2213a2ba58d4245e12a6:0
  • value  18522062343
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 1faeea5b1af5d120ac99b06d31c2ecbc8e677acedc7a2213a2ba58d4245e12a6:1
  • value  4163534
    address  182xNYLKC4m8ZHPfHBkbx6pYQFJQBFgA2J